The Echoes of a Symphony: The Last Resonance

In the desolate town of Aria, where the wind howled through the hollows like a spectral wail, there was a legend that resonated through the ages. It spoke of a symphony, a melody that only the lost could hear, a song that carried the voices of the departed into the ears of the living. This symphony, known as "The Hollow's Resonance," was said to be the final whisper of souls that had been forsaken by time.

Evelyn had grown up in Aria, a place where the living and the dead seemed to coexist in an uneasy truce. Her childhood was filled with the sound of wind chimes, the echo of the symphony, and the scent of lavender that her grandmother, a lighthouse keeper, used to keep the spirits at bay. Evelyn had always been able to hear the symphony, a gift she thought was unique to her, until the night her grandmother vanished without a trace.

Now, years later, Evelyn had become a lighthouse keeper in her own right. The lighthouse, a beacon of hope in the stormy nights of Aria, stood as a testament to her grandmother's courage. It was there that Evelyn first encountered the music of the symphony with an intensity she had never felt before. The melody was haunting, beautiful, and yet so deeply sorrowful that it felt as if it were a living entity, reaching out to her with a desperate plea.

One stormy night, as the waves crashed against the cliffs and the wind howled, Evelyn's phone rang. The caller ID read "Unknown." Her heart pounded as she answered, and a voice filled with a sorrow so profound it seemed to come from the depths of the ocean itself spoke to her.

"You have been chosen," the voice said. "The symphony seeks you."

Evelyn was confused. She had never been chosen for anything. But the voice was persistent, and as the storm raged on, she realized that the symphony was calling her not just to hear its song, but to interpret it. It was a call to uncover the truth about her grandmother's disappearance and the mysterious symphony that had haunted her entire life.

Determined to find answers, Evelyn embarked on a journey that would take her into the heart of Aria's dark past. She discovered that the symphony was not just a melody, but a code, a language of the lost that had been kept secret for generations. Each note of the symphony held a piece of the puzzle, and as she pieced it together, she uncovered a web of lies, betrayal, and a love that transcended life and death.

Evelyn met other souls who had been touched by the symphony, each with their own story of loss and longing. Among them was a musician named Leo, whose life had been destroyed by the symphony's power. Together, they delved deeper into the symphony's origins, only to find that the melody was not just a song, but a key to unlocking a door to the afterlife.

As the storm reached its peak, Evelyn and Leo found themselves face to face with the source of the symphony—a grand piano, standing in the ruins of an old concert hall. The piano, covered in dust and cobwebs, seemed to be waiting for them, its keys glowing with an otherworldly light.

Evelyn sat down and began to play. The notes she struck resonated with the very fabric of the world, and as the symphony reached its crescendo, the spirits of the lost surrounded them. Evelyn felt their sorrow, their joy, their unfulfilled dreams, and she knew that she had to find a way to bring them peace.

The climax of the story arrived when Evelyn played a final, haunting melody that seemed to reach the very core of existence. The spirits of the lost began to fade away, their voices joining the symphony of the universe. Evelyn looked around and saw that the concert hall was being rebuilt, a testament to the love and memory of those who had been lost.

With the symphony's power now under control, Evelyn returned to the lighthouse. She sat on the edge of the cliff, watching the waves crash against the rocks below. The wind had died down, and the sky was beginning to clear. Evelyn felt a sense of peace, knowing that she had brought the lost souls to rest.

As she gazed out over the ocean, she heard a whisper, a melody that was both familiar and new. It was the symphony, and it was calling her once again. But this time, it was not a call to despair, but a call to hope. Evelyn smiled, knowing that she had found her purpose, and that the symphony would always be with her, a reminder of the power of love and the enduring spirit of the lost.

The story of Evelyn and the symphony of the lost would be told for generations, a tale of courage, love, and the eternal bond between the living and the departed. And so, the legend of the Hollow's Resonance continued, a symphony that played on, forever resonating in the hearts of those who dared to listen.
